Can shipping containers and solar power be used as portable energy solutions?
The mobility of shipping containers and solar power presents opportunities for portable energy solutions. Mobile power stations can be created by equipping containers with solar panels, batteries, and inverters. These stations can be deployed for temporary events, construction sites, or emergency power needs.

What are the advantages of shipping container solar?
Modularity is a key advantage of shipping container solar installations. Solar panels can be installed modularly, allowing for easy expansion or reconfiguration as power demands increase or location requirements change. This scalability ensures that solar power systems adapt to evolving needs and circumstances.

How do pipeline operators schedule and batch shipments?
Pipeline operators must carefully schedule and batch pipeline shipments from different shippers to ensure shipments are sent at correct quantities, time intervals, and order to delivery locations while maintaining a continuous, uninterrupted flow of products. How is crude oil transported?
Crude oil must be moved from the production site to refineries and from refineries to consumers. These movements are made using a number of different modes of transportation. Crude oil and refined products are transported across the water in barges and tankers. On land crude oil and products are moved using pipelines, trucks, and trains.
How do oil refineries transport crude oil?
Pipeline and ocean vessels have historically been the most common forms of carrying crude oil to refineries. Rail and truck movements, however, have gained traction in the past decade due to lacking pipeline infrastructure and operational constraints in certain geographies.

As of July 2025, the 20 ft shipping container price to buy ranges from about $2,100 for a used container to $3,700+ for a new (one-trip) container. These prices can shift depending on location, condition, and features like high cube height or extra doors.
